Billable Hours started in 2018.

Jeff (guitar) was photographing a wedding, and Darren (drums) called him out of the blue. While catching up about music, they had an idea — get the band back together.

They started playing as a duo, until Thomas joined (bass).

Darren met Eugene (keyboards) at their daughters’ school, and he joined soon after.

In 2019, Darren met Steffi (vocals) through one of her colleagues. To this day, they’re surprised she keeps coming to rehearsal.

When the pandemic hit in 2020, everything changed, even the lineup. Sean (bass) originally joined as a sub for one gig, and became a permanent member in lockdown.

 

Steffi Chan

Lead Singer, Tambourine, Cowbell

Steffi Chan grew up in Walnut, California, serenaded by her mom singing her favorites like Yesterday, Unchained Melody, and Summertime, in her deep, soulful voice. Steffi was inspired by her mom’s talent, her home infused with a love of music, and artists like Mariah Carey, Celine Dion, Whitney Houston, and Aretha Franklin. Steffi has performed in countless shower concerts for unwitting neighbors, and her passion for karaoke at work functions led a colleague to introduce her to Billable Hours. The rest is history.

Eugene Wang

Keyboards, Vocals, Guitar

Eugene hails from Memphis, Tennessee where he spent his formative years listening to a multitude of musical genres spanning R&B, country, pop and rock. Although he sang in a traveling a capella group while in high school, he didn’t discover his interest in instruments until much later in life. As an adult, he began learning to play the guitar and years later, realized he could play guitar chords on the piano. Since then, he has continued his learning by experimenting with different playing styles by ear, as he does not read music. Often on the road, you may find Eugene fighting jet lag in piano bars from Paris to New York City.

Darren Schulte

Drums, Backup Vocals

Darren has been playing drums since he was a teenager living in LA. He thought that drums would be key to playing gigs on the Sunset Strip rather than the clarinet, his first instrument. Since leaving college, Darren has played in several rock and indie bands around the Bay Area, keeping his professional musician dreams alive. Darren started Billable Hours with Jeff in 2018 to bring rock, soul, R&B, and country hits to bars and events everywhere.

Sean Carmichael

Bass, Backup Vocals

Sean is a lifelong musician and has been an electric bass player for over 20 years. His early music career included playing jazz bass in and around the Chicago area, singing in a touring boy choir, playing classical piano, and more. After moving to the Bay Area, he played in jazz groups until joining Billable Hours in early 2020.
